> The Problem:
> During a real Wi-Fi authentication, my rlm_rest instance (guest_auth)
> consistently returns noop, which causes the mschap module to fail with
> ERROR: FAILED: No NT-Password.

  Looking at the source code to rlm_rest, the only time it returns NOOP is when there's no relevant section in the configuration.

  i.e. you're listing "rest" in the "authorize" section, but then mods-enabled/rest doesn't have an "authorize" configuration.
